WELCOME TO THE SNACK SHACK
The Rye Little League Snack Shack is a fund raising venture for the Rye Little League.  It is run solely by parent volunteers.  Every family with a child playing in the Major Leagues and AAA league is asked to take a turn or two running the snack shack.  A schedule has been prepared based on the two teams playing and each family taking turns. You work during a game your child is playing in. 
 
PLEASE REVIEW THE SNACK SHACK SCHEDULE UNDER DOCUMENTS & FORMS SECTION OF THE WEBSITE.
 
Please find your name and the dates you are scheduled to run the snack shack.  If you are unable to work the shack on your scheduled date, it is up to YOU to find a replacement, by switching a game with another family from your child’s team. 

A Little League of America policy, prevents us from hiring a student to work your shift.   If you switch with a family from yourteam, please note it on the schedule posted in the Snack Shack, so it is known who to expect to work that game.
 
THE FIRST NAME IS THE OPENER - THE SECOND NAME IS THE CLOSER
You are scheduled as either the “Opener” or the “Closer”.  Both adults on the schedule work the entire shift, including
set-up and clean-up. The Opener picks the cash box up at Christin Keehbler’s house about 45 minutes before game
time.  Both people scheduled to work should be at the Snack Shack about 30 minutes before game time.   The Closer
returns the cash box to Christin’s house after clean-up is complete.  Her address is 10 Whitehorse Drive.
Both Opener & Closer set up the snack shack and clean up the snack shack. 
Please do not leave one person to do the clean up - it's a process that is best completed by 2 or more individuals. 
 
If a game that you were scheduled to work the snack shack is canceled and rescheduled, you are responsible for working the shack on the rescheduled date.
 
If you are a “No-Show” for your scheduled shift, and have not taken the responsibility to find a replacement, you will be assigned two additional shifts during the play-offs.   We are all volunteering our time, so please be respectful of everyone's time and commitment.
 
We will need additional volunteers to run the shack during the play-off games in June.  You will be contacted once the schedule is made.
 
THANK YOU FOR YOUR HELP.  THIS COMMUNITY EFFORT IS WHAT MAKES THE SNACK SHACK A PROFITABLE VENTURE, WHICH IN TURN ENABLES THE RYE LITTLE LEAGUE TO PURCHASE NEEDED SUPPLIES AND EQUIPMENT.
